  4. Mining

    @GHOSTTOWNAS(http://www.ghosttownaz.info/)
    • Mining is a business activity that contributes a lot to Global warming and environmental degradation. In the article Mining Impacts by Greenpeace International, it says that “bad mining practices can ignite coal fires, which can burn for decades, release fly ash and smoke laden with greenhouse gasses and toxic chemicals. Furthermore mining releases coal mine methane, a greenhouse gas 20 times more powerful than carbon dioxide. Coal dust inhalation causes black lung disease among miners and those who live nearby, and mine accidents kill thousands every year. Coal mining displaces whole communities, forced off their land by expanding mines, coal fires, subsidence and contaminated water supplies”, which means that mining affects not only our environment, but also affects the people on the site and the people living near the mining sites. Therefore, mining should be minimized, because it is very dangerous to our health and environment.
  5. Deforestation

    • Lastly, deforestation is also a major factor that contributes to Global warming and also our extinction, because it destroys not only our forest, but also the Earth. By cutting a lot of trees, we are reducing the supply of oxygen that we need in order to live on Earth. It also increases the amount of carbon dioxide in the air which is lethal to our system, because deforestation decreases the number of trees and plants that absorb this gas. Therefore, we will not be able to breath and live long on Earth, and the consequences of Global warming will gradually increase and even more perilous. In addition to that, deforestation destroys and limits the habitats of animals and other plants.
